Top 5 Final Fantasy Games Performance on Unified Platform in Ireland Q1 2022
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 Final Fantasy games on a unified platform in Ireland during Q1 2022, including weekly revenue, downloads, and active users.
Throughout Q1 2022, the top 5 Final Fantasy games on a unified platform in Ireland showcased diverse performance trends in terms of weekly revenue, downloads, and active users. Below is a comprehensive breakdown of each game's performance.
DISSIDIA FINAL FANTASY OO saw a notable increase in weekly revenue, reaching approximately $450 in early February and peaking at $372 towards the end of the month. Downloads were relatively modest, with a peak of 17 in the week of February 21.
Final Fantasy XV: A New Empire experienced fluctuating weekly revenue, starting at $284 in late December, dipping to $145 in early February, and peaking at $568 in late March. Downloads remained minimal, with a slight increase to 3 in early February.
FINAL FANTASY BE:WOTV showed varied revenue trends, starting at $257 and peaking at $498 in late March. Downloads were minimal initially, with a notable increase to 21 by the end of March. Active users remained steady at 31 throughout the quarter.
FINAL FANTASY BRAVE EXVIUS reported a steady weekly revenue with a peak of $326 in late February. Downloads were relatively low, with a peak of 9 in the same period. Active users remained consistent at 10 during the quarter.
FINAL FANTASY Record Keeper experienced stable but low revenue, peaking at $87 in late March. Active users showed a slight decline from 49 in late December to 34 by the end of March.
